Basically I want to call JasperViewer from a button on my Main Application.
I use this

private void btnExportActionPerformed(java.awt.event.ActionEvent evt) {
        try {
            JasperPrint printer = JasperFillManager.fillReport(getClass().getResourceAsStream("reportRecharge.jasper"), params, new JREmptyDataSource());
            JasperViewer jv = new JasperViewer(printer);
            jv.setVisible(true);
        } catch (JRException ex) {
            ex.printStackTrace();
        }
}

When a JasperViewer appear and I close it, the main frame / parent also closed. I’ve try adding jv.setDefaultCloseOperation(HIDE_ON_CLOSE); but it’s not working either. How to get it?

Any help would be appreciated.

    change like below. if you add false the default exit on close property becomes false.

    private void btnExportActionPerformed(java.awt.event.ActionEvent evt) {
            try {
                JasperPrint printer = JasperFillManager.fillReport(getClass().getResourceAsStream("reportRecharge.jasper"), params, new JREmptyDataSource());
                JasperViewer jv = new JasperViewer(printer,false);
                jv.setVisible(true);
            } catch (JRException ex) {
                ex.printStackTrace();
            }
    }
